Staring at People Staring at Phones is a video installation that invites viewers to observe intimate moments of people absorbed in their phones.

Focusing on their expressions, body language, and interactions with screens, the piece explores how digital technology is reshaping the way we connect, pay attention, and understand ourselves. It addresses the loneliness epidemic, where the constant presence of digital connectivity creates a paradox of isolation, deepening the sense of disconnection in an increasingly connected world.

This project was co-produced with V2_ Lab for the Unstable Media as part of the Summer Sessions art and technology residencies.
